Abstract
A method and apparatus for the treatment of the 5th Effect combined evaporator condensate generated by kraft process pulp mills. The method includes the removal from effluents of organic compounds that result in BOD, COD and toxicity by the use of reverse osmosis. Through the use of a reverse osmosis membrane system there is provided a simple, economical and efficient treatment process for clean evaporator condensate, and in particular the 5th Effect combined evaporator condensate.
